Ingredients for Black Velvet Cakes (Makes 12 Cupcake-Sized Cakes)

Each ingredient has been selected to create the signature deep flavor and luscious texture of these cakes.

  • 1 ½ cups all-purpose flour
    Provides the base structure for the cakes, ensuring a tender crumb.
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
    Sweetens the cake and helps retain moisture.
  • 2 tablespoons unsweetened cocoa powder
    Gives a mild chocolate flavor and contributes to the dark hue.
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
    Acts as a leavening agent to give the cakes their rise.
  • ½ teaspoon salt
    Enhances all the flavors and balances the sweetness.
  • ¾ cup buttermilk (room temperature)
    Adds tanginess and ensures a moist texture.
  • ½ cup vegetable oil
    Creates a soft, rich crumb and keeps the cakes tender.
  • 2 large eggs (room temperature)
    Bind the batter and add structure.
  • 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
    Infuses a warm, aromatic flavor throughout the cake.
  • 1 teaspoon white vinegar
    Reacts with the baking soda for a light texture and bright crumb.
  • 1 teaspoon black gel food coloring
    Creates the bold, signature black hue without affecting flavor.

Step-by-Step Instructions for Perfect Black Velvet Cakes

Step 1: Preheat and Prep

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a 12-cup muffin tin with black or silver cupcake liners to match the dramatic tone of the cakes.

Step 2: Combine Dry Ingredients

In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, sugar, cocoa powder, baking soda, and salt. This ensures even distribution of leavening and flavor.

Step 3: Mix Wet Ingredients

In a separate bowl, whisk the buttermilk, oil, eggs, vanilla extract, vinegar, and black food coloring until fully combined and smooth.

Step 4: Combine Wet and Dry

Gradually add the wet ingredients to the dry, stirring gently with a spatula or mixer on low speed. Do not overmix—this will keep the cakes tender.

Step 5: Fill and Bake

Divide the batter evenly among the prepared cupcake liners, filling each about 2/3 full. Bake for 18–20 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.

Step 6: Cool Completely

Let the cakes cool in the pan for 5 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ely before frosting.

Pro Tips for Bakery-Quality Results

  • Use gel food coloring: Gel provides intense color without watering down your batter.
  • Room temperature ingredients: Ensures smooth mixing and a consistent crumb.
  • Sift your cocoa powder and flour: Remove clumps and aerate the batter.
  • Don’t overbake: The key to a velvety cake is moistness—check at the 18-minute mark.

Serving Suggestions

Black Velvet Cakes are versatile and ideal for upscale presentation:

  • Top with cream cheese frosting for a tangy, classic velvet pairing.
  • Add a chocolate ganache glaze for extra indulgence.
  • Serve with fresh berries or a drizzle of raspberry coulis for a gourmet touch.
  • Perfect for Halloween, New Year’s Eve, or elegant dinner parties.
